Ahmed Rabei appointed new Palestine ambassador to Pakistan
ISLAMABAD, APR 25 (DNA)- Ahmed Rabei has been appointed as new Palestine ambassador to Pakistan. According to diplomatic sources Ahmed Rabei is a veteran and seasoned diplomat having immense experience in the field of diplomacy.
He has arrived to replace erstwhile Palestine ambassador Walid Abu Ali, who was posted as Palestine ambassador in Malaysia.
Pakistan and Palestine enjoy excellent relations and it is expected that these relations would get further boost during the tenure of new ambassador Ahmed Rabei.=DNA
